Cardinals’ QB Murray Inactive Due to Foot Injury Against Packers

Arizona Cardinals quarterback Kyler Murray will not play this Sunday due to a foot injury. This marks his second consecutive game missed. Sources indicate he is expected to return after the bye week, specifically for a Monday night matchup against the Dallas Cowboys on November 3.

Jacoby Brissett Steps in as Starting Quarterback

With Murray sidelined, Jacoby Brissett will take over the starting role against the Green Bay Packers. Last week, Brissett showcased his skills despite the loss against the Indianapolis Colts. He completed 27 of 44 passes for a total of 320 yards, achieving two touchdowns and one interception.

Cardinals’ coach Jonathan Gannon has been cautious when commenting on Murray’s health. The team’s official stance remains non-committal regarding his return for the upcoming game against the Packers.
